S+T+ARTS Hungry EcoCities

Hungry EcoCities

About project

Hungry EcoCities explores through experiments and prototypes the need for a more healthy, sustainable, responsible, and affordable agri-food system. It puts forward a high-level alliance between science, technology, and the arts, to effectively explore how digital technologies & AI applications can lead in turn to reduced food waste, more sustainable value chains, eco-friendly attitudes, and more ethical food consumption. How can increased awareness and technological tools impact a future where we use resources responsibly to produce and consume food? In Hungry EcoCities, studios, universities, growers, and agricultural specialists team up with, artists and creative thinkers to come up with new ideas for the future food system. Hungry EcoCities will hosts 19 S+T+ARTS residencies and will be working towards defining, designing, and developing AI-enabled responsible, art-driven solutions for the end-users in the agri-food industries.
